/ Timeline
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Parents and children of check-in [ce8177e3e6]

2015-06-30
15:10
Make use of built-in bswap32() and bswap16() functions in GCC/Clang for a significant performance improvement there. check-in: 8bfcda3d10 user: drh tags: trunk
14:01
Only use <nowiki>__builtin_bswap16()</nowiki> with GCC 4.8 and later. Closed-Leaf check-in: ce8177e3e6 user: drh tags: bswap-functions
13:28
Remove the use of htonl() in the previous check-in due to linkage issues. Add the get2byteAligned() macro and use it for access to the cell offsets on btree pages for about a 1% performance gain. check-in: 79ff36b717 user: drh tags: bswap-functions